How To Vacuum Seagrass Rug. To maintain your seagrass rug’s cleanliness, start by regularly vacuuming it. In dry climates, lightly mist the rug with water to strengthen the fibers, but avoid saturation. Do not use a beater bar. Regular vacuuming is the best care to keep the appearance of your seagrass rug fresh. Visible and loose dirt should be vacuumed with a strong suction vacuum. Avoid steam cleaning or wet shampooing and opt for dry cleaning. When it comes to maintaining the cleanliness and appearance of your seagrass rug, spot cleaning is a crucial step. Use a v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ment or set. To maintain a seagrass rug, vacuum it a few times a week with a strong suction vacuum, avoiding the use of a beater bar. A v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ment will be essential for removing loose dirt and debris from the rug.
